sarahs investment grew 12% to $280 how much did she invest?

let x = the original amount x + .12x = 280 1.12x = 280 x = 250 the original amount she invested is $250. :)

you could also do a check: 250 + .12(250) = 280? 250 + 30 = 280 280 = 280 so it checks out x3
